To qualify for a real estate broker license you must complete a minimum of 168 hours of qualifying education. The qualifying education must be obtained through either a nationally accredited community college or university OR a school approved by the Colorado Department of Private and Occupational Schools (DPOS).

Commission Rule D-14 states: Every active real estate licensee, including real estate companies, shall have in effect a policy of errors and omissions insurance to cover all acts requiring a license.

You must be at least 18 years old to get started. Complete 168-Hours of Pre-Licensing Courses. Pass the Pre-License Course Final Exam. Pass the Real Estate Exam. Submit Fingerprints and Complete a Background Check. Provide Proof of Errors & Omissions Insurance. Apply for Your License.
